Most simple implementation of external ceph support.
We use INI merge to configure RBD backend for Glance and copy
ceph.conf and keyring provided by the user into the container.
Set_configs.py had to be extended to support globbing (wildcards) in
order to copy ceph keyring file which is named depending on the cephx
user name.

In most of case, the disks used by ceph have different size. Use the
default value 1 may block the ceph when one disk is full. Use the disk
size as osd weight will more reasonally.

Pin the base distro release version in the master branch(Newton).
Only one distro version is supported. The supported versions are:
* CentOS: 7
* RedHat: 7
* OracleLinux: 7
* Debian: 8
* Ubuntu: 14.04
NOTE: Kolla will move to Ubuntu 16.04 in the Newton cycle

centos-release-openstack-mitaka 1.3 is now available via the
delorean-mitaka-testing repo. We need to install this directly instead
of the 1.2 version as otherwise the subsequent 'yum update' tries to
install it and fails on the centos-release dependency which is
incompatible with the oraclelinux base.

As suggested it was created the variable KOLLA_SERVICE_NAME to identify
the container service name through PS1 shell variable.
This method it was previously discussed in IRC.
https://goo.gl/k7AdEg
The other option it was usage hostname param in kolla_docker, but
currently docker does not support it due this issue:
https://github.com/docker/compose/issues/2460
The final result is like this:
$ docker exec -it heka /bin/bash
(heka)[heka@kolla-control /]$
$ docker exec -it mariadb /bin/bash
(mariadb)[mysql@kolla-control /]$

The rabbitmq-server package is upgraded to 3.5.7 in cloud-archive
so we update centos to match
The xen-utils package now needs an explict version, xen-utils-4.6 is
what is provided by cloud-archive mitaka
Libvirt 1.3 is in the ubuntu cloud-archive. This has a new daemon for
logging that needs further implementation in newton. For now, it has
been disabled within the qemu.conf

The code in docker/base/start.sh that waits for the log socket does
not work because it includes a bad "space" character after "-S".
This patch changes that character to a real "space" character. It
also sets the SKIP_LOG_SETUP envvar for the Heka container.
